So, JP Imagine experts like Michael have been going around, saying that CP items are completely okay balance-wise, when compared to normal items. CP = cash point, which is the term used in the JP version. AP/Aeria Point items are their equivalent on the EN version.
Since many claims that CP items are just for looks and offer little or no real advantage. Shall we take a look at what an ignorant JP player use?
I’ve ~100 m.attack and ~90 p.attack, netting an effective m.attack of 145 for my demolition rushes.
Taking that into account, an armor piece that add 1 m.attack would increase my damage by 1/145 => ~0.6% for my rushes or ~1% for my normal spells.

Out of the remaining items, are there any alternatives? Well, yes and no.
Ear/Ring have the +4 p/m/rng,attack blood stained stuff, but recall what I say earlier. 4 m.attack is a 4% increase for shot, 2% increase for rushes. This 4/2% value will also drop the more p/m/rng.attack you have.
Drawback-wise, they also only have 5 durability, making them pretty hard to use for grinding especially once you lose durability from repairs.
Drill comp, which is sold in stores add 10% magic/melee damage, and eventually 10% gun damage as well after a patch. This is about the only non-cp upgrade that is actually viable.
The other slots? Good luck finding any armor that adds stats, let alone damage boosts.
Putting weapon aside, I gain a total of:
+ 43% magic damage
+ 15% fire damage
+ 12% shot/12% rush
+ 10/20% racial damage
Total: 80/90% damage increase.
On top of this, I’ve -15% cast time/-15% cooldown for ALL skill. I also have a 31% boost to guns/melee if I actually use them.
A mage without CP items will have:
+ 10% magic damage {drill comp}
+ 4/8% damage from stats
Total 14/18% damage increase.
So, a difference of 60% in the best case, and 74% in the worst case.
In addition, damage boost in SMT are multiplicative, rather than additive, so the difference is even bigger:
1 x 1.43 x 1.15 x 1.12 x 1.1 => ~2.03
1 x 1.43 x 1.15 x 1.12 x 1.2 => ~2.21
1.04 x 1.10 => ~1.14
1.08 x 1.10 => ~1.18
(2.21 – 1.14) x 100 = 107%
(2.03- 1.18) x 100 = 85%
So, someone using CP has an actual damage boost of 107% more that someone without CP in the worst case scenario, and 85% in the best case.
I haven’t even factor in weapons, modification or boost from enchants, which will further skew the data towards CP items.

As for zodiac stones, some of them are useful, but the full set bonus for having 12/13 stones is very weak. As a mage, the only one I use on a somewhat regular basis is Aquarius. (ice/extra slot)
Ophiuchus (zan/ring) is the other stone that I might use if I have it, but it’s given out only during events, making it the rarest stone on the JP server currently.
Gunner tend to use Scorpio (rifle/earring) as there are quite a few things that are weak to rifles in Ichigaya/Suginami Gold.
Melee might use Capricorn (slash/glove) or Libra (blunt/weapon) to brute force their way though resistance. However, Taurus (pierce/head) isn’t really used much since using it prevents you from using the set bonus from 4 kings.
Other stones are just too rare and/or have too specific uses.
IS the four kings set really that special? Since it supposedly increases Rush time and Spin Cooltime…
Short answer: Yes.
The base bonuses are:
+10% damage to all skills which depends on weapons for damage type. (IOWs every melee skill)
+10% rush/spin damage
+ 15 int
+ 15 stamina
Rush takes 60% longer to cast
Spin’s cooldown increased by 120%
If chaos, you gain these additional bonuses:
+5% slash/blunt/pierce damage
+10% damage agaist law enemy.
If law, you gain these penalties:
-100hp
-15 p.attack
10%(weapon) + 5% (slash/blunt/pierce) = 15%, just 5% shy of the 20% pierce boast given by Taurus.
Remember, there’s the spin/rush boast as well, and all the damage increase, less the 5% slash/blunt/pierce boast works with all damage type.
Considering that I can only remember 1 mob i.e. Hecate, who is weak to pierce only, pretty easy to see which is more beneficial.
In addition, rush isn’t really a main form of attack for melee once they get geared up with lottery items as lottery tend to favor spin/attack stuff for melee.
Increased spin cooldown though is quite a penalty, but it’s partially alleviated by the fact that you’ve 3 different spin at class 5 and 4 different spin at class 7 to use. Also, stamina reduce cooldown after a patch, which mitigate some of the cooldown increase.
tl;dr: For a chaos melee, the bonuses from 4 kings is quite significant. It’s pretty decent for neutral characters as well.

Bonus wise, chaos offers the most for melee (4 kings, bishamonten for +3 str, tarot enchant, 10% universal fire boast from surt, 15% magical boast from loki etc…) but neutral have some perks too.
Chernobog gives 10 str for a head slot enchant (same as Taurus) and gives an additional 5 str if you’re neutral, bringing the total boast to 15str, which is ~7% damage. Drawback of taking 30% more blunt damage and 20% more fire damage.
There’s also Tanki for your top, which grants 30% knockback prevention, 100% if you’re neutral but you take 50% additional damage.
No knockback is quite a huge advantage for melee as it prevent you from being stunned by skills/spells as well. This means you can use your normal attack and/or use an item at all times.
Got countered? Not a problem, you can land the next hit immediately if you’ve tanki enchanted. A devil threw a spell at you? Again not a problem as you recover instantly and can quickly walk up and attack them.
The additional damage is a pain to deal with though, but can be alleviated by hotkeying two different healing items and spamming them if you get attacked.
Just don’t go Law, unless you really like the devils, as there are close to 0 perks usable by a Law melee. Law mages/gunners however are a different case.

1 m.attack is always around 1% and only becomes less than 1% when your m.attack-mob’s m.def is more than 100.
Takemikazuchi does get better than decarabia/hel but it’s not practical for someone to aim to tarot it in 13 slots. Comparatively, Flamis gives 2% fire, which is more bang/buck compare to takemikazuchi and in the end game, no one cares about anything other than fire damage.
